Italian oil giant's $5.5bn project in Norwegian Arctic set to launch by the end of the year
Italian oil giant Eni has vowed to press ahead with oil production in the Arctic by the end of the year, undeterred by Shell's decision to abandon its quest for Arctic oil. As environmentalists celebrated...
